Product Description
There’s only one hero who can save us from the Symbiote’s Youtooz takeover and that’s Spider-Man! Wait… Is he ok?? Will we be ok?! At 4.9 inches tall and posed with his hands and feet perched atop the corner of a web-covered building, the thick black goo of the Symbiote oozes up from the building and around his body as it consumes him with thick wrapping tendrils. With his head lowered and a pair of bright white eyes staring forward, he has almost been completely engulfed by darkness as only a thin sliver of his red and blue suit remains visible.
The exterior of his packaging shows Spider-Man's ‘Spider-sense’ going off as he’s taken over by the Symbiote, while the interior is covered in the light grey panels of Marvel comics. The dark protective sleeve is then covered in a maze of webs as his figure can be seen through the large clear window at the packaging’s front. This collectible ships in a matte, embossed, protective outer sleeve and a custom-sized plastic protector for maximum protection during shipping.
Product Features
- 4.9 inches tall (12.4cm)
- Made of vinyl
- Based on the Symbiote Spider-Man: Marvel Tales #1 comic cover variant
- Unique stylized design
- Non-articulated

Founded by Martin Goodman and later launched as Marvel in 1961, Marvel has become an iconic comic book publisher that has expanded to other media like films and video games with a great amount of success. Marvel is home to iconic superheroes like Spider-man, Iron Man, Hulk, Captain America, and many more. Marvel has seen another level of success and popularization with the launch of the brand's Marvel cinematic universe beginning in the late 2000's.
